NotesSome source of material available on Rotherham Grammar School (ii)

Broadbent. M Education in Rotherham during the period 1837-1970. College long essay. [942.741/370]
Christie J. J The wisdom of numbering our days, a sermon..... by the Head Master of the Grammar School 1873 [942.741/825.8 CHR Pamphlet]
Grammar School Form of service for the unveiling and dedication of a memorial..... 1925 [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Grammar School Report of the first annual examination. 1863 [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Grammar School Report of the second annual examination. 1864 [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Grammar School Rotherham Grammar School, 1483-1933 (by W H Green & H Wroe) 1939 [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Grammar School School songs, selected from Gudeamus songs.... 1892 [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Great Britain Charity Commissioners. Endowed charities (W.R. of York) 1895 [942.741/361]
Board of Education Great Britain. Report of inspection of Rotherham Grammar School..... June 1926 [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Guest, J. Historic Notices of Rotherham 1879 [942.741]
Guest, J Rotherham Ancient college and Grammar school 1876
Reilly, H.P History of technical education in Rotherham with particular reference to the period 1850-1918. Thesis (1951?) [942.741/370]
Rotherham County Borough Education Cttee. Rotherham Grammar School: official opening of new extensions 1961 [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Woodward, R Development of education in Rotherham to 1944. Thesis 1968 [942.741/370]
Yorkshire Archaeoligical Society Record Series. Early Yorkshire Schools by A.F. Leach. 1903 [942.74/370]
Yorkshire Life Illustrated. February 1960. Article on Rotherham Grammar School by S. Cole [942.741/373 Pamphlet]
Austen, F.W. Rectors of two Essex parishes. 1943 [942.741/370] - contains information on Hoole.

Other sources of information are to be found on approximately 70 extries on the index cards in the Local Studies. Also available is bound volume of press cuttings and oral history cassettes. Who's Who files are a source of information on Masters and Old Boys.
Illustrations - engraving of old school at bottom of Moorgate and few of school at top of Moorgate
Maps - 1851 (large scale) shows position of school in area now All Saints Square.

Location of archives unknown - school log books 1948 onwards were held at the school (date when Mr Gunner took over as Headmaster)- information accurate in 1975.
